The Amazon Prime UX Design team is at the heart of the Prime membership. We innovate and design on behalf of our customers and are relentlessly focused on improving the membership experience to delight hundreds of millions of customers around the globe. We are seeking an AI-fluent UX Designer to join our Design Systems team and drive the day-to-day evolution of the Prime Design Library (PDL). In this role, you will be a builder and maintainer of our component library, ensuring consistency, quality, and scalability across all Prime customer experiences. You will partner closely with UX designers, front-end engineers, and product teams to translate design intent into well-structured, reusable components that power Prime globally. This is a hands-on, technically curious design role. You will bridge the gap between visual design craft and systematic thinking, working at the intersection of design tooling, component architecture, and engineering collaboration. The ideal candidate is passionate about bringing order to complexity, loves the details of how components are named, layered, and configured, and is excited about emerging agentic design workflows. AI fluency and hands-on experience developing and maintaining design systems are critical. Key job responsibilities - Design Systems building and maintaining design systems, shared library of reusable components that all product teams draw from - Help evolve the Prime Design Library (PDL) design system, particularly with component creation, maintenance, documentation, and quality standards - Align builds to machine-readable contract and maintain production-readiness in partnership with engineering - Review other designers’ work for PDL and semantic compliance - Advocate for system thinking and AI scalability across the organization - Run sync cadences with partner teams and guide WW Prime UX designers on design system usage - Along with our Design Technologist, partner with Engineering teams as the design point of contact for component implementations - Build and iterate on design tooling (plugins, linters) and support agentic design workflow exploration
